Eillen
EYE-leen
Eillen is a girl’s name of Irish origin, meaning “A variation of Eileen, an Irish name, which is an Irish form of Helen, meaning "light" or "bright one."”, and peaked in popularity in 1921.
What Eillen Means
“A variation of Eileen, an Irish name, which is an Irish form of Helen, meaning "light" or "bright one."”

Eillen is a delicate variation of Eileen, itself an Irish form of the classic Helen. This lineage traces back to ancient Greece, where Helen symbolized radiant beauty and the light of the sun. Its recorded presence began in 1921, the very year sound started to revolutionize cinema.
